If you don't know, I have been off prozac for almost 2 months now. I am currently taking wellbutrin twice a day and xanax as needed.
So here's what I am experiencing:
First 3 weeks of no prozac was fine.
After the above came the withdrawals.
My new doctor wanted to try me on wellbutrin for a few different reasons. The main 2 being; having more energy and to stop smoking. In no way does it take away the prozac withdrawals. They get worse each day, but I'm learning how to manage. The withdrawal process can last up to a year depending upon how long a person was on prozac and what the daily intake was.
Anyway, here is what I have began experiencing since wellbutrin was introduced:
First week started having crazy dreams.
Sleep walked for the first time in my life. I woke up only to see myself washing my hands....in my sleep.
Waking up from a dead sleep to beat wasps off of me. These, of course, were not really there.
Last night has to be the funniest so far. I sleep texted. Really?? Who seriously picks up their phone, in their sleep, and sends a text that was part of a dream? I even placed proper punctuation in the text.
I'm kind of curious as to what is coming next. Sleep walking down the street naked? Driving in my sleep? Or worse??
Oh yea, it isn't helping with my smoking problem.
